Awarded on:
February 8th, 1943
Awarded for his distinguished leadership of the 17. Panzer-Division during the following actions in the winter of 1942/43...

1) The battles between the Volga and the Don during the attempted relief of the 6. Armee in Operation Wintergewitter.

2) During the defensive and retreat battles on the Kazakh steppe.

3) The fighting along the Manytsch river, where his Division was able to throw Soviet forces back across the river on the 24.01.1943.

Kommandierender General XIV.Panzer-Korps / 10.Armee / Heeresgruppe C
Awarded on:
April 5th, 1944
Awarded for his outstanding leadership of German forces during the 1st (17.01.-18.02.1944) and 2nd (15.-23.03.1944) battles of Monte Cassino, the latter of which was a clear German victory.
